Angharad,

Welcome. I manage editing as I go by reviewing what I wrote the previous session, making corrections and then adding new words. Then, the next session, I review/edit the new words from the last session, then add more until the novel is finished. It's a balanced approach and works for me while helping me get back into the scene/action.
